Super Giants regain top spot in SA20 standings

The Durban outfit climbed one level clear on the top of the desk.

Recovering from a shaky begin, Durban’s Super Giants secured a dominant 57-run victory over Paarl Royals at Boland Park on Friday night time as they regained top spot in the SA20 standings.

An unbeaten half-century from Quinton de Kock laid the inspiration for the guests as they secured their fifth victory from seven matches this season, whereas handing the Royals their second defeat.

Despite being lowered to 54/2 after eight overs, after selecting to bat, the guests have been capable of change gears as De Kock managed to stay his heels in, turning their innings round.

He shared 113 runs for the third wicket with JJ Smuts earlier than Smuts was eliminated in the 18th over after contributing 52 runs off 39 balls.

De Kock, who survived a scare in the latter phases of the innings when he had a call overturned by overview, went on to mix in a 48-run partnership with Heinrich Klaasen as they guided their staff to a formidable complete.

Carrying their aspect to 190/3, De Kock made an unbeaten 83 off 51 deliveries (together with 5 fours and 5 sixes), whereas Klaasen hit 30 not out off simply 9 balls.

Royals innings

In response. chasing a formidable complete of 191 runs to win, the Royals have been anchored by opening batter Jos Buttler who bashed 45 runs off 36 balls.

He didn’t obtain sufficient help, nevertheless, with solely three of his teammates – Andile Phehlukwayo (18),  Bjorn Fortuin (13) and Mitchell van Buuren (11) – reaching double figures.

Leading their aspect to a powerful victory, the Super Giants bowling assault mixed effectively. All six gamers who got the ball took wickets, led by Marucus Stoinis (who returned 3/24) and Keshav Maharaj (2/24), because the guests managed to bowl their opponents out for 133 runs in the ultimate over of their innings, grabbing some useful factors in the opening spherical of the favored T20 competitors.

Durban’s Super Giants may have a chance to increase their lead on the top of the SA20 standings at Kingsmead on Sunday, whereas the Paarl Royals may have a chance to bounce again and regain management when the 2 sides sq. off in their return conflict.
